Fire and arson scene evidence : a guide for public safety personnel / written and approved by the Technical Working Group on Fire/Arson Scene Investigation.

Actions taken at the outset of an investigation at a fire and arson scene can play a pivotal role in the resolution of a case. Careful, thorough investigation is key to ensuring that potential physical evidence is not tainted or destroyed or personal witnesses overlooked. This guide is one method of promoting quality fire and arson scene investigation.
